1.Differentiation of Candida albicans and Candida dubliniensis using Latex Agglutination Test.
Korean Journal of Medical Mycology 2017;22(1):15-20
BACKGROUND: Candida dubliniensis is phenotypically similar to Candida albicans that may be underdiagnosed in clinical laboratory. In 2010, C. dubliniensis was first recovered from blood of a candidemia patient in Seoul, Korea. Also, a simple commercial latex agglutination (LA) test is available. OBJECTIVE: The aim of the present study was to investigate the prevalence of C. dubliniensis among isolates in our stocks during 2-years period (2010-2011) and to evaluate the ability of LA test (Bichro-Dubli Fumouze®) for the differentiation of C. albicans and C. dubliniensis. METHODS: A total 509 isolates including 504 C. albicans and 5 C. dubliniensis were examined for LA test, the presence of “spiking” on blood agar plate, and the germ tube test. Also all isolates were tested using the VITEK 2 ID-YST system. RESULTS: No C. dubliniensis was found in 504 isolates of initially identified as C. albicans. The LA test was positive only in 5 clinical isolates and 2 type strains of C. dubliniensis. CONCLUSIONS: The data show that the prevalence of C. dubliniensis in Korea is still expected to be extremely low and LA test is very rapid, simple, and reliable tool for the differentiation of C. albicans and C. dubliniensis.

2.Comparison of Automated Treponemal and Nontreponemal Test Algorithms as First-Line Syphilis Screening Assays.
Hee Jin HUH ; Jae Woo CHUNG ; Seong Yeon PARK ; Seok Lae CHAE
Annals of Laboratory Medicine 2016;36(1):23-27
BACKGROUND: Automated Mediace Treponema pallidum latex agglutination (TPLA) and Mediace rapid plasma reagin (RPR) assays are used by many laboratories for syphilis diagnosis. This study compared the results of the traditional syphilis screening algorithm and a reverse algorithm using automated Mediace RPR or Mediace TPLA as first-line screening assays in subjects undergoing a health checkup. METHODS: Samples from 24,681 persons were included in this study. We routinely performed Mediace RPR and Mediace TPLA simultaneously. Results were analyzed according to both the traditional algorithm and reverse algorithm. Samples with discordant results on the reverse algorithm (e.g., positive Mediace TPLA, negative Mediace RPR) were tested with Treponema pallidum particle agglutination (TPPA). RESULTS: Among the 24,681 samples, 30 (0.1%) were found positive by traditional screening, and 190 (0.8%) by reverse screening. The identified syphilis rate and overall false-positive rate according to the traditional algorithm were lower than those according to the reverse algorithm (0.07% and 0.05% vs. 0.64% and 0.13%, respectively). A total of 173 discordant samples were tested with TPPA by using the reverse algorithm, of which 140 (80.9%) were TPPA positive. CONCLUSIONS: Despite the increased false-positive results in populations with a low prevalence of syphilis, the reverse algorithm detected 140 samples with treponemal antibody that went undetected by the traditional algorithm. The reverse algorithm using Mediace TPLA as a screening test is more sensitive for the detection of syphilis.

3.Prevalence and characteristics of Shiga toxin-producing Escherichia coli (STEC) from cattle in Korea between 2010 and 2011.
Eun KANG ; Sun Young HWANG ; Ka Hee KWON ; Ki Yeon KIM ; Jae Hong KIM ; Yong Ho PARK
Journal of Veterinary Science 2014;15(3):369-379
A total of 156 Shiga-like toxin producing Escherichia coli (STEC) were isolated from fecal samples of Korean native (100/568, 18%) and Holstein dairy cattle (56/524, 11%) in Korea between September 2010 and July 2011. Fifty-two STEC isolates (33%) harbored both of shiga toxin1 (stx1) and shiga toxin2 (stx2) genes encoding enterohemolysin (EhxA) and autoagglutinating adhesion (Saa) were detected by PCR in 83 (53%) and 65 (42%) isolates, respectively. By serotyping, six STEC from native cattle and four STEC from dairy cattle were identified as O-serotypes (O26, O111, O104, and O157) that can cause human disease. Multilocus sequence typing and pulsed-field gel electrophoresis patterns highlighted the genetic diversity of the STEC strains and difference between strains collected during different years. Antimicrobial susceptibility tests showed that the multidrug resistance rate increased from 12% in 2010 to 42% in 2011. Differences between isolates collected in 2010 and 2011 may have resulted from seasonal variations or large-scale slaughtering in Korea performed to control a foot and mouth disease outbreak that occurred in early 2011. However, continuous epidemiologic studies will be needed to understand mechanisms. More public health efforts are required to minimize STEC infection transmitted via dairy products and the prevalence of these bacteria in dairy cattle.

4.Disseminated cryptococcal lymphadenitis with negative latex agglutination test.
Xiao-Guang XU ; Xin-Ling BI ; Jian-Hua WU ; Hong XU ; Wan-Qing LIAO
Chinese Medical Journal 2012;125(13):2393-2396
We reported an unusual case of disseminated cryptococcal lymphadenitis in an immunocompetent host who presented with fever and lymphadenopathy, which were the only two symptoms and signs. Latex agglutination test of serum and cerebrospinal fluid (CSF) were negative, while lymph node biopsy showed Cryptococcus neoformans. A diagnosis of disseminated cryptococcal lymphadenitis was made. Then the patient was treated with amphotericin B for 15 days as initial therapy and itraconazole for 6 months as maintenance therapy respectively. The patient received re-examination per 6 months and was followed up for 2 years. Swollen lymph nodes diminished gradually, and no fever or other symptoms were found. Latex agglutination test of serum and CSF were negative throughout the follow-up period, and anti-HIV, syphilis and tuberculosis antibody were all negative.

5.Latex agglutination test based prevalence of Toxoplasma gondii in native Korean cattle.
Eun Sik SONG ; Sang Il JUNG ; Bae Keun PARK ; Myung Jo YOU ; Duck Hwan KIM ; Kun Ho SONG
Korean Journal of Veterinary Research 2011;51(1):75-77
The prevalence of Toxoplasma (T.) gondii was surveyed using a latex agglutination test (LAT) in native Korean cattle. A blood sample was collected from female 105 cattle in the Daejeon area of Korea. All cattle were asymptomatic and had not received any prophylactic treatment for T. gondii. Blood samples were collected via the caudal vein. The cattle ranged in age from 2~6 years (mean 3.7 years). LAT detected antibody to T. gondii in four of 105 (3.8%) cattle. 6.Value of latex agglutination test in the diagnosis and treatment of cryptococcal meningitis in children.
Xing-Zhi CHANG ; Ruo-Yu LI ; Yu-Qi WANG ; Shuang WANG ; Hui XIONG ; Ye WU ; Xin-Hua BAO ; Yue-Hua ZHANG ; Jiong QIN
Chinese Journal of Contemporary Pediatrics 2011;13(2):115-118
OBJECTIVETo evaluate the value of cryptococcal latex agglutination test in the diagnosis and treatment of cryptococcal meningitis in children.
METHODSThe clinical data of 10 children with cryptococcal meningitis were retrospectively studied. Cryptococcal meningitis was confirmed based on clinical manifestations, India ink stain, cryptococcal latex agglutination test or cryptococcal culture. The outcome of antifungal treatment and the changes of latex agglutination test titer were followed up for 2 to 4 years.
RESULTSLatex agglutination test and/or India ink stain were positive (titer 1 : 64-1 : 1024) in 8 patients in the first examination of cerebrospinal fluid. In the other 2 patients, latex agglutination test was positive (titer 1 : 256) in the fourth examination of cerebrospinal fluid in one, and India ink stain was positive in the eleventh examination in the other. After antifungal treatment, six patients were cured, two patients died, and two patients were lost to follow-up. The positive cryptococcal latex agglutination test (titer 1 : 2-1 : 16) was seen respectively in six, three, two and one cured patients 6 months, 1 year, 2 years and 4 years later.
CONCLUSIONSThe cryptococcal latex agglutination test of cerebrospinal fluid is valuable for the quick and early diagnosis of cryptococcal meningitis; however, the decision of withdrawal of antifungal treatment should not rely on the results of the test.

7.Annual Report on External Quality Assessment in Immunoserology in Korea (2009).
Young Joo CHA ; So Yong KWON ; Think You KIM ; Jae Ryong KIM ; Hyon Suk KIM ; Myong Hee PARK ; Seong Hoon PARK ; Ae Ja PARK ; Jai Hoon BAI ; Han Chul SON ; Kye Sook LEE ; Seok Lae CHAE
Journal of Laboratory Medicine and Quality Assurance 2010;32(1):45-68
The followings are the results for external quality assessment (EQA) in immunoserology for 2009: Evaluation of EQA was done in 2 trials in April and November, about 99% of laboratories participating average 7.4 items. The results were collected via internet and about 98% of laboratories have sent their results via internet. Control materials used in EQA were pooled sera including commercial controls, MASR Immunology Control from Medical Analysis Systems (Camarillo, CA, USA), which were delivered refrigerated for stability of control materials, being received within 48 hours after sending. Latex agglutination tests for rheumatoid factor (RF) showed frequently false positive or false negative results especially in commercial controls, possibly due to matrix effect. False negative and positive results were frequently found in the laboratories using immunochromatography assay (ICA) for anti-HCV and anti-HIV. More careful quality control should be required for ICA tests. New tests measuring non-treponemal and trponemal antibody such as turbidoimmunoassay (TIA) and chemiluminescence immunoassay (CLIA) were introduced. Standardization of instruments and reagents including calibrators for quantitative results should be required for the harmonization of results.

8.Porcine abortion outbreak associated with Toxoplasma gondii in Jeju Island, Korea.
Jae Hoon KIM ; Kyung Il KANG ; Wan Cheul KANG ; Hyun Joo SOHN ; Young Hwa JEAN ; Bong Kyun PARK ; Yongbaek KIM ; Dae Yong KIM
Journal of Veterinary Science 2009;10(2):147-151
This report deals with the acute onset of an abortion outbreak and high sow mortality in one pig herd consisted of 1,200 pigs and 120 sows on Jeju Island, Korea. Affected pregnant sows showed clinical signs, including high fever, gradual anorexia, vomiting, depression, recumbency, prostration, abortion, and a few deaths. Four dead sows, five aborted fetuses from the same litter, and 17 sera collected from sows infected or normal were submitted to the Pathology Division of the National Veterinary Research and Quarantine Service for diagnostic investigation. Grossly, hepatomegaly and splenomegaly were observed in sows. Multiple necrotic foci were scattered in the lungs, liver, spleen, and lymph nodes. Microscopically, multifocal necrotizing lesions and protozoan tachyzoites were present in the lesions. Tachyzoites of Toxoplasma (T.) gondii were detected immunohistochemically. Latex agglutination showed that the sera of 7 of 17 (41.2%) sows were positive for antibody to T. gondii. The disease outbreak in this herd was diagnosed as epizootic toxoplasmosis. To our knowledge, this is the first report of porcine toxoplasmosis with a high abortion rate and sow mortality in Korea.

9.Utility of D-dimer Assay for Diagnosing Pulmonary Embolism: Single Institute Study.
Rojin PARK ; Young Ik SEO ; Soon Gyu YOON ; Tae Youn CHOI ; Jeong Won SHIN ; Soo Taek UH ; Yang Ki KIM
The Korean Journal of Laboratory Medicine 2008;28(6):419-424
BACKGROUND: Pulmonary embolism (PE) presents with diverse non-specific signs and symptoms and its diagnosis mainly depends on diagnostic imaging tests which are laborious and not cost-effective, and only a small proportion of patients with suspected PE actually have the disease. The aim of this study was to analyze the utility of D-dimer test for diagnosing PE by categorizing patients into 'PE likely' and 'PE unlikely' groups using Wells score for clinical probability. METHODS: One hundred forty consecutive patients with clinically suspected PE, in whom D-dimer and imaging tests were performed were enrolled. Dignosis of PE was made when the imaging tests were positive. Wells scores were retrospectively assigned and the dignostic utility of D-dimer test was analyzed. RESULTS: Of the 140 patients studied, D-dimer test was positive in 97 and diagnostic imaging tests revealed PE, deep vein thrombosis (DVT), and PE+DVT in 24, 3, and 7 patients, respectively. For the diagnosis of PE, D-dimer test with cutoff value of > or =230 ng/mL showed sensitivity, specificity, and negative predictive value of 96.8%, 39.6%, and 97.7%, respectively. These values were 96.3%, 37.9%, and 91.7% in 'PE likely' group (n=56), and 100%, 38.8%, and 100% in 'PE unlikely' group (n=84). Among 43 patients with D-dimer values of <230 ng/mL, only one patient was diagnosed with PE, who belonged to the 'PE likely' group. CONCLUSIONS: D-dimer test cannot be used as a stand-alone test to diagnose PE, but it can be helpful for exclusion of PE especially in 'PE unlikely' group according to Wells score.

10.Evaluation of the Korean Isolate-1 Tachyzoite Antigen for Serodiagnosis of Toxoplasmosis.
Eun Hee SHIN ; Dong Hee KIM ; Aifen LIN ; Jo Woonyi LEE ; Hyo Jin KIM ; Myoung Hee AHN ; Jong Yil CHAI
The Korean Journal of Parasitology 2008;46(1):45-48
To evaluate the usefulness of the Korean Isolate-1 (KI-1) antigen for serodiagnosis of toxoplasmosis, antigen profiles of KI-1 tachyzoites were analyzed in comparison with RH tachyzoites by SDS-PAGE and immunoblotting. ELISA was performed on latex agglutination (LA)-positive and negative serum samples using KI-1 and RH antigens. Immunoblotting of the KI-1 antigen showed multiple antigen bands with molecular sizes of 22-105 kDa. Among them, 1 and 6 common bands were noted against a KI-1-infected and a RH-infected human serum, respectively, which represented differences in antigenic profiles between KI-1 and RH tachyzoites. However, all 9 LA-positive human sera were found positive by ELISA, and all 12 LA-negative sera were negative by ELISA; the correlation between the ELISA titers and LA titers was high (r = 0.749). Our results suggest that tachyzoites of KI-1 may be useful for serodiagnosis of human toxoplasmosis.
